microcontrolador pic 16f84
TRANSCRIPT
-
8/7/2019 Microcontrolador PIC 16F84
1/14
-
8/7/2019 Microcontrolador PIC 16F84
2/14
yUn microcontrolador es uncircuito integrado o chip que
incluyeen su interior las tresunidades funcionales de unacomputadora: CPU,M
emoria y
Unidades de E/S.
-
8/7/2019 Microcontrolador PIC 16F84
3/14
yLa unidad central deprocesamiento o CPU (por el
acrnimo en ingls decentralprocessing unit), o simplementeelprocesador o microprocesador,
-
8/7/2019 Microcontrolador PIC 16F84
4/14
yesel componente del computador yotros dispositivos programables,
que interpreta lasinstruccionescontenidasen los programas yprocesa losdatos
-
8/7/2019 Microcontrolador PIC 16F84
5/14
Desde la invencin del circuitointegrado, el desarrollo constante de laelectrnica digitalha dado lugar a dispositivos cada vezmas complejos. Entreellos losmicroprocesadores y
los microcontroladores, los cualessonbsicosen las carreras de ingeniera
-
8/7/2019 Microcontrolador PIC 16F84
6/14
ySe comienza describiendo lascaractersticas ms representativasde los PIC.
y1. La arquitectura del procesador
sigueel modelo HarvardyEn esta arquitectura, el CPU se
conecta de forma independiente ycon buses distintos con
yla memoria de instrucciones y con
la de datos.
-
8/7/2019 Microcontrolador PIC 16F84
7/14
yAplicaciones
y
Para explicar el funcionamiento deun microcontrolador nosbasaremosen el PIC16F84A,
fabricado por la CompaaMicrochip (www.microchip.com).Es uno de los chips ms comunes
quese incluyeen casi la totalidadde los libros de uso prctico de losmicrocontroladores PIC.
-
8/7/2019 Microcontrolador PIC 16F84
8/14
-
8/7/2019 Microcontrolador PIC 16F84
9/14
-
8/7/2019 Microcontrolador PIC 16F84
10/14
yPara funcionar el PIC slo requiere+5 Volts de alimentacin y un
cristal con la frecuencia adecuada,para el caso del PIC 16F84 acepta 4y 20 MHz.
-
8/7/2019 Microcontrolador PIC 16F84
11/14
yEl ahorro de componenteses tal quehasta la conexin de diodosLED ydisplays 7segmentosse hace directa,
no requiere resistencias para limitar lacorriente, el PIC lo tiene interno.Incluso hay versiones ms pequeasde 8 pines que ni siquiera requieren
un oscilador, viene includo en elmismo chips.
-
8/7/2019 Microcontrolador PIC 16F84
12/14
y Un ejemplo de la aplicacin de un PIC 16F84.
-
8/7/2019 Microcontrolador PIC 16F84
13/14
-
8/7/2019 Microcontrolador PIC 16F84
14/14
yEsteejemplo es un termostato
electrnico, usa el PIC16F870 quetiene la caracterstica de configurar4 entradas anlogas (0 a 5 Volts),internamenteel conversorA/Dtrabaja con resolucin de 8 bit (255
pasos), unos 0,019 Voltssi se tomacomo escala los 5 Volts. Laconexin del LCDes directa al PIC.